THE SALVATION ARMYNORTH & CENTRAL ILLINOIS DIVISION MIDWAY CITADEL CORPS & COMMUNITY CENTERPOSITION DESCRIPTIONPOSITION TITLE Youth MentorLOCATIONDEPT Midway Citadel Corps & Community CenterREPORTS TO Youth Program CoordinatorFLSA CATEGORY Non-ExemptSTATUS TYPE RPTPAY GARDE 203PAY RANGE 18.11 - 21.74DEPARTMENT MISSION Midway Citadel Corps is conducting a mentoring program that includes youth development mentoring best practices curriculum driven cohort style mentoring and trauma-informed mentoring programming during out of school hours and during the summer months with youth who are enrolled in Chicago Public Schools Option schools. The program serves youth who are homeless or are unstably housed youth who are justice involved opportunity youth ages 16-24 who are out of school and not working youth who are English as a second language learners and youth who have endured trauma.OUTCOMESAs a result of participation in the DFSS Youth Services Mentoring Program the Youth Mentors should be able to provide youth with safe supportive and age-appropriate activities that foster a strong relationship with a mentor a sense of community amongbetween peers and increase their social and emotional competence that results in better decision making and responsibility.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IESFacilitate direct and supervise all programmatic activities with youth.Build strong positive relationships with youth and facilitate team building between groups giving youth a sense of dignity and belonging.Assist Program Lead Counselors and Program Counselors with implementing curricula engage youth in learning and recreational activities.Assist with implementing creative strategies to retain youth throughout the program.Engage youth in wrap around services within The Salvation Army and work with external partners to provide additional support services to youth who may need it.Act as the liaison to youth agency families and DFSS personnel.Assist with data collection and entry into Cityspan SIMS and other DFSS-designated platforms.Implement performance measurement tools with youth and ensure completion.Attend mandatory training and learning meetings per request of DFSS including but not limited to training for Cityspan and a DFSS-designated technology platform.Complete all required training and certifications in order to remain in good standing.Illinois Mandated Reporter Training Certificate & Acknowledgment of Mandated Reporter Status Form annual.Cardiopulmonary resuscitation CPR and First Aid Certification.REPORTING RELATIONSHIPS This position reports to the Youth Program Coordinator.In contacts related to this positions duties this individual acts as a representative of The Salvation Army and its mission.PERFORMANCE MEASUREMENTSThis individual will be evaluated on how effectively the outcomes of this position are achieved timeliness and accuracy of accomplishing assigned goals will be reviewed and an evaluation of how effectively service is provided.A 30 60 and 90-day performance review will be conducted.EDUCATIONEXPERIENCE A High School Diploma or GED equivalent required.3 years of experience working with community outreach-based programs.An exposure to social services or faith-based organizations is preferred.COMPETENCIES Willing to promote the mission of The Salvation Army.An enthusiastic and friendly approach to job duties with the ability to lead others positively.Willingness to learn and participate in DFSS-sponsored professional development trainings meetings conferences etc.Good communication and interpersonal skills.An attention to detail procedures processes and policies.Ability to use initiative and to be a self-starter.A positive attitude and the ability to be flexible in light of changing job situationspriorities.POSITION LIMITATIONSThis individual will only commit Army resources that have not been allocated or approved.This individual will keep the Youth Program Coordinator informed on all critical issues relating to their area of responsibility.This individual will adhere to all policies and procedures in carrying out the responsibilities of this position.PHYSICAL DEMANDSWORK ENVIRONMENTThis position is required to do light to moderate physical work and must be able to lift or move up to 25 lbs.In order to successfully perform the essential functions of this position the employee is regularly required to use office equipment and including PC and gym equipment.Must be able to work with clients that have poor social skills suffer from mental illness and have substance abuse problems.Maintain a positive work atmosphere by behaving and communicating in a manner that fosters and maintains positive relationships with co-workers and supervisors.
